New strategies for freezing, advancing relfrozenxid early

Edit
ID 3843
Title New strategies for freezing, advancing relfrozenxid early
Topic Performance
Created 2022-08-25 21:29:40
Last modified 2023-01-26 06:23:49 (1 year, 9 months ago)
Latest email 2023-01-27 18:40:10 (1 year, 9 months ago)
Status
2023-01: Withdrawn
2022-11: Moved to next CF
2022-09: Moved to next CF
Target version
Authors Peter Geoghegan (pgeoghegan)
Reviewers Matthias van de Meent (mmeent)Become reviewer
Committer
Links CFbot results (CirrusCI) CFbot GitHub Wiki
Checkout latest CFbot patchset Go to your local checkout of the PostgreSQL repository and run:
git remote add commitfest https://github.com/postgresql-cfbot/postgresql.git
git fetch commitfest cf/3843
git checkout commitfest/cf/3843
Emails
New strategies for freezing, advancing relfrozenxid early
First at 2022-08-25 21:21:12 by Peter Geoghegan <pg at bowt.ie>
Latest at 2023-01-27 18:40:10 by Peter Geoghegan <pg at bowt.ie>
Latest attachment (v17-0001-Add-eager-and-lazy-freezing-strategies-to-VACUUM.patch) at 2023-01-24 22:49:38 from Peter Geoghegan <pg at bowt.ie>
    Attachment (v17-0001-Add-eager-and-lazy-freezing-strategies-to-VACUUM.patch) at 2023-01-24 22:49:38 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v16-0003-Finish-removing-aggressive-mode-VACUUM.patch) at 2023-01-16 18:10:25 from Peter Geoghegan <pg at bowt.ie> (Patch: No)
    Attachment (v15-0001-Add-eager-and-lazy-freezing-strategies-to-VACUUM.patch) at 2023-01-09 01:45:41 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v14-0001-Add-eager-and-lazy-freezing-strategies-to-VACUUM.patch) at 2023-01-03 20:30:02 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(0001-Tweak-page-level-freezing-comments.patch) at 2023-01-02 19:45:11 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v13-0002-Add-eager-and-lazy-VM-strategies-to-VACUUM.patch) at 2022-12-28 17:34:02 from Peter Geoghegan <pg at bowt.ie> (Patch: No)
    Attachment (v12-0002-Add-eager-and-lazy-freezing-strategies-to-VACUUM.patch) at 2022-12-26 20:53:52 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v11-0001-Add-page-level-freezing-to-VACUUM.patch) at 2022-12-22 19:39:10 from Peter Geoghegan <pg at bowt.ie> (Patch: No)
    Attachment (v10-0005-Finish-removing-aggressive-mode-VACUUM.patch) at 2022-12-18 22:20:49 from Peter Geoghegan <pg at bowt.ie> (Patch: No)
    Attachment (v9-0005-Finish-removing-aggressive-mode-VACUUM.patch) at 2022-12-11 02:11:21 from Peter Geoghegan <pg at bowt.ie> (Patch: No)
    Attachment (v8-0004-Add-eager-freezing-strategy-to-VACUUM.patch) at 2022-11-23 23:06:52 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v7-0005-Avoid-allocating-MultiXacts-during-VACUUM.patch) at 2022-11-19 01:06:57 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v6-0005-Avoid-allocating-MultiXacts-during-VACUUM.patch) at 2022-11-16 03:02:12 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(routine-vacuuming.html) at 2022-10-17 23:52:11 from Peter Geoghegan <pg at bowt.ie> (Patch: No)
    Attachment (v4-0001-Add-page-level-freezing-to-VACUUM.patch) at 2022-09-13 17:53:06 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v3-0001-Add-page-level-freezing-to-VACUUM.patch) at 2022-09-08 20:23:52 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v2-0001-Add-page-level-freezing-to-VACUUM.patch) at 2022-08-31 22:05:52 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
    Attachment (v1-0001-Add-page-level-freezing-to-VACUUM.patch) at 2022-08-25 21:21:12 from Peter Geoghegan <pg at bowt.ie> (Patch: Yes)
History
When Who What
2023-01-26 17:23:31 Matthias van de Meent (mmeent) Added mmeent as reviewer
2023-01-26 06:23:49 Peter Geoghegan (pgeoghegan) Closed in commitfest 2023-01 with status: Withdrawn
2022-12-13 23:50:56 Ian Barwick (barwick) Closed in commitfest 2022-11 with status: Moved to next CF
2022-12-13 23:21:24 Peter Geoghegan (pgeoghegan) Changed wikilink to https://wiki.postgresql.org/wiki/Freezing/skipping_strategies_patch:_motivating_examples
2022-12-13 23:21:05 Peter Geoghegan (pgeoghegan) Changed wikilink to https://wiki.postgresql.org/wiki/Freezing/skipping_strategies_patch:_motivating_examples#Opportunistically_advancing_relfrozenxid_with_bursty.2C_real-world_workloads
2022-10-17 23:52:37 Peter Geoghegan (pgeoghegan) New status: Needs review
2022-10-12 08:31:00 Michael Paquier (michael-kun) Closed in commitfest 2022-09 with status: Moved to next CF
2022-10-12 08:30:57 Michael Paquier (michael-kun) New status: Waiting on Author
2022-08-25 21:29:49 Peter Geoghegan (pgeoghegan) Changed authors to Peter Geoghegan (pgeoghegan)
2022-08-25 21:29:40 Peter Geoghegan (pgeoghegan) Attached mail thread CAH2-WzkFok_6EAHuK39GaW4FjEFQsY=3J0AAd6FXk93u-Xq3Fg@mail.gmail.com
2022-08-25 21:29:40 Peter Geoghegan (pgeoghegan) Created patch record
Edit